re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

References

tools/clang/include/clang/AST/NonTrivialTypeVisitor.h
   46   Derived &asDerived() { return static_cast<Derived &>(*this); }
tools/clang/lib/CodeGen/CGNonTrivialStruct.cpp
   71   Derived &asDerived() { return static_cast<Derived &>(*this); }
  213   Derived &asDerived() { return static_cast<Derived &>(*this); }
  219 struct GenUnaryFuncName : StructVisitor<Derived>, GenFuncNameBase<Derived> {
  219 struct GenUnaryFuncName : StructVisitor<Derived>, GenFuncNameBase<Derived> {
  284 struct GenDestructorFuncName : GenUnaryFuncName<GenDestructorFuncName>,
  285                                DestructedTypeVisitor<GenDestructorFuncName> {
  286   using Super = DestructedTypeVisitor<GenDestructorFuncName>;
  870   GenDestructorFuncName GenName("", Alignment, Ctx);
  878   GenDestructorFuncName GenName("__destructor_", DstPtr.getAlignment(),
  995   GenDestructorFuncName GenName("__destructor_", DstAlignment, Ctx);